Introduction

Since 1983, the U.S. Public Health Service (PHS) has worked to establish a structured agenda for women’s health. That year, the Assistant Secretary for Health commissioned the PHS to form the Task Force on Women’s Health Issues. This initiative aimed to identify critical health concerns affecting women and integrate them into public health priorities. Over the years, debates have emerged regarding the sufficiency of federal efforts in addressing women’s healthcare needs, particularly in research funding and inclusion in clinical studies.

In 1987, the General Accounting Office (GAO) assessed National Institutes of Health (NIH) funding for women’s health research. The findings revealed that approximately 13.5% of the NIH budget—around $778 million—was allocated to women’s health issues. Some groups interpreted this to mean that the remaining 86.5% focused predominantly on men’s health. However, NIH clarified that 80% of its funding was dedicated to studies on diseases affecting both genders or fundamental research benefiting the entire population. Despite this, concerns persisted about the extent to which women were included in research study populations and whether female-specific health concerns received adequate attention.

The underrepresentation of women in NIH-funded research has drawn increasing scrutiny from policymakers. Many members of Congress have viewed NIH’s response as insufficient and urged a review of its policies. A GAO report highlighted that NIH had made limited progress in ensuring the inclusion of women in clinical studies. In response, NIH issued a revised policy statement in 1990, later republished in 1991, emphasizing the need for greater female representation in research.

Ongoing debates continue to address key concerns such as the proportion of research funding allocated to women’s health, the inclusion of women in clinical trials, and potential disparities in disease treatment based on sex. To improve gender equity in medical research, NIH and other agencies must ensure that women’s health issues receive appropriate attention and resources.

The Framingham Study

Initiated in 1948, the Framingham Study is a long-term, prospective research project designed to identify the impact of genetic, biological, and environmental factors—such as lifestyle, occupation, and smoking—on the development of atherosclerosis and hypertension. The study is funded by the National Heart, Lung, and Blood Institute (NHLBI) of the National Institutes of Health (NIH).

The research involved recruiting approximately two-thirds of the population of Framingham, Massachusetts, later supplemented with additional participants. Of these individuals, 2,873 were women. Participants underwent biennial medical evaluations, which included physical exams, cardiovascular assessments, chest X-rays, and laboratory tests for parameters such as blood glucose, cholesterol, hematocrit, and urine chemistry. Data on coronary artery disease, cerebrovascular conditions, and mortality were collected and analyzed.

Menopause-Related Findings

The study provided important insights into menopause and its health implications. Researchers found that menopause occurred earlier in smokers (average age: 49.3 years) compared to nonsmokers (50.1 years). Additionally, the transition through menopause—whether natural or due to surgical removal of the ovaries (bilateral oophorectomy)—was associated with increased hemoglobin and cholesterol levels. However, no significant changes were observed in body weight, blood pressure, glucose levels, or lung function.

Further analysis revealed a higher incidence of coronary heart disease (CHD) in postmenopausal women compared to premenopausal women, along with increased disease severity at the time of treatment. Surgical menopause was found to increase the risk of CHD by 2.7 times. Another significant finding was that smokers using estrogen therapy had an elevated risk of heart attacks. Interestingly, unlike most studies that suggest estrogen use provides cardiovascular benefits, the Framingham researchers reported a 50% higher risk of cardiovascular disease and a twofold increase in cerebrovascular disease among estrogen users.

However, a reevaluation of the Framingham data led to some modifications of these conclusions. When researchers focused solely on myocardial infarction, the increased risk was not as significant. Additionally, variations in risk assessment depended on the baseline data used. Another limitation was that only 302 women in the study were estrogen users, which may have influenced the findings.

A follow-up study involving the offspring of the original participants found that postmenopausal estrogen users had improved cardiovascular markers, including higher HDL cholesterol, lower LDL cholesterol and glucose levels, and lower diastolic blood pressure. However, the positive effect on HDL cholesterol was observed primarily in women who had undergone oophorectomies.

In the initial study, oral-conjugated estrogens (such as Premarin) were the primary form of hormone therapy. In the offspring study, Premarin remained the most commonly used estrogen therapy, although 10% of participants also took progestins. However, the impact of progestins on cardiovascular health was not assessed in either study.

Evaluating the Effects of Hormone Therapy

Assessing the health effects of hormone therapy requires rigorous research beyond observational studies due to the potential for selection bias. Women who choose hormone therapy—or whose doctors prescribe it—often differ from nonusers in ways that can influence disease risk, making it challenging to determine whether observed health outcomes result from the therapy itself or underlying factors. Randomized controlled trials (RCTs) are the gold standard for minimizing these biases by ensuring that hormone users and nonusers are comparable in all respects except for the treatment received.

Selection bias, a major concern in nonrandomized studies, can obscure the true effects of hormone therapy. For instance, many studies fail to document the specific reasons for prescribing or withholding estrogen, making it difficult to account for preexisting physiological differences between users and non-users. Women prescribed hormone therapy may initially be healthier or more symptomatic, which can affect their risk for subsequent diseases. Conversely, nonusers may include women who cannot tolerate hormones due to underlying health conditions, further complicating comparisons.

The "healthy user" effect is another source of bias in hormone therapy research. Physicians often avoid prescribing hormones to women with preexisting illnesses or known contraindications, leading to an apparent increase in disease risk among nonusers. Additionally, hormone users typically receive more frequent medical checkups, which can result in earlier detection and treatment of health conditions, skewing outcomes in favor of users. Addressing these biases requires well-designed studies, careful statistical adjustments, and, when possible, randomized trials to ensure reliable conclusions about the risks and benefits of hormone therapy.
